RSM’s International Tax Business practice is a national capability that focuses on serving US and Foreign multi-national business’ US international tax advisory and compliance needs in coordination with foreign tax advisors and applicable laws.  This includes advising businesses on the application of US and foreign tax law to a business and how that impacts their choices and decisions to structure their legal entities, transactions, and operations.  This practice includes compliance for accurately reporting and administering global tax obligations.  

Examples of the candidate’s responsibilities include:

  • Supporting the team to provide clients with strategic, integrated tax solutions focused on outbound and inbound structuring​ 
  • Demonstrating a general knowledge of foreign tax credits​ 
  • Completing tax planning and research ​ 
  • Developing an understanding of worldwide tax minimization, transfer pricing, and accounting for income taxes​ 
  • Assisting with IFRS/GAAP convergence and foreign assignment planning  ​ 
  • Working with businesses around the world to build successful cross-border tax strategies
